AI in Python
Are you curious about how AI can be seamlessly integrated into your Python projects If youre wondering how to harness the power of artificial intelligence in a language thats renowned for its simplicity and versatility, youre in the right place! AI in Python offers a wide array of tools, libraries, and frameworks that allow you to build intelligent applications, analyze data, and solve complex problems with striking efficiency.
As someone who has dabbled extensively in Python programming, I can attest to the sheer power and accessibility of AI within this language. From machine learning algorithms to natural language processing, Python allows developers to leverage sophisticated AI techniques without needing an extensive background in mathematics or statistics. My experiences have shown me that anyone with a foundational understanding of Python can create applications that leverage AI, making it an exCiting time to explore this technology.
Understanding the Fundamentals of AI with Python
Before diving into practical applications, its essential to grasp the underlying principles of AI. At its core, artificial intelligence involves enabling machines to mimic human-like intelligence, learning from experience, and making data-driven decisions. Python shines in this domain because of its rich ecosystem of libraries that simplify the implementation of AI algorithms.
Tools like TensorFlow and PyTorch provide extensive functionalities for machine learning, allowing developers to create and train models efficiently. Similarly, libraries like NLTK and SpaCy simplify natural language processing tasks. The community support for these libraries is immense, ensuring that you can find help or resources easily, contributing to the trustworthiness of using AI in Python.
Getting Started with AI in Python
If youre eager to start using AI in Python, begin with some foundational tutorials on machine learning. Websites like Kaggle offer datasets and notebooks where you can test your skills in a community-focused environment. After that, consider projects that can solidify your understanding. For instance, building a recommendation system can provide insights into both collaborative filtering and content-based filtering techniques.
To enhance your learning experience, remember to document your projects. This not only solidifies your understanding but serves as a portfolio that showcases your expertise and experience, which is crucial for credibility in the world of AI development. Whether you want to write blog posts detailing your projects or present them in community forums, sharing your insights will build your authoritativeness in the field.
Real-World Applications of AI in Python
Lets explore some practical uses of AI in Python. One of the most exCiting applications I worked on involved using computer vision to develop a solution that automates quality checks in manufacturing processes. By training a convolutional neural network using OpenCV and TensorFlow, we could analyze images in real-time and detect defects that would be missed by the human eye. This project was not only fulfilling but also demonstrated how AI could enhance operational efficiency significantly.
Another compelling project focused on sentiment analysis of customer reviews using natural language processing. Leveraging libraries like NLTK, I analyzed thousands of reviews, extracting meaningful insights that helped a business refine its products. The results were clear businesses that embrace these AI tools can wait less on customer feedback and adapt quicker according to sentiment trajectory.
Integrating AI in Python with Business Solutions
Integrating AI into business processes not only optimizes workflows but also unlocks profound insights from data. Companies like Solix provide solutions that enable businesses to store, manage, and analyze vast amounts of data efficiently. By utilizing Solix EDG, businesses can create a data landscape that enhances their AI initiatives in Python.
For instance, by harnessing Solix solutions alongside your AI projects, you can ensure that the data youre working with is well-structured and relevant, crucial for training reliable models. Because AI thrives on data, having a robust solution like Solix is fundamental to developing systems that can deliver trustable outcomes.
Challenges and Considerations
While the potential of AI in Python is immense, there are challenges to consider. Data quality is paramount; poor data can lead to unreliable model predictions. Make it a habit to perform thorough data cleaning and preprocessing before diving into model development.
Ethical considerations also play a significant role in AI. As developers, its our responsibility to ensure fairness and transparency in our algorithms. Being aware of knowledge gaps and unconscious biases during development can help mitigate these issues, enhancing the trustworthiness of your AI solutions.
Concluding Thoughts on AI in Python
AI in Python is an exCiting field filled with potential for developers. Its versatility and ease of use make it an attractive choice for those looking to dive into artificial intelligence. Whether youre keen on building applications or delving into data analytics, the journey is rewarding and impactful.
If youre looking to explore the intersection of AI and efficient data management, consider contacting Solix for insights into how their solutions can complement your AI endeavors. You can reach Solix at 1.888.GO.SOLIX (1-888-467-6549) or through their contact pageExploring these solutions may unlock new levels of innovation in your projects.
About the Author Hi, Im Priya! My fascination with AI in Python has spurred my journey through coding and data analysis. I love sharing practical insights and real-world applications of technology that Ive experienced firsthand.
Disclaimer The views expressed in this blog are my own and do not necessarily reflect the official position of Solix.
Sign up now on the right for a chance to WIN $100 today! Our giveaway ends soon—dont miss out! Limited time offer! Enter on right to claim your $100 reward before its too late!
DISCLAIMER: THE CONTENT, VIEWS, AND OPINIONS EXPRESSED IN THIS BLOG ARE SOLELY THOSE OF THE AUTHOR(S) AND DO NOT REFLECT THE OFFICIAL POLICY OR POSITION OF SOLIX TECHNOLOGIES, INC., ITS AFFILIATES, OR PARTNERS. THIS BLOG IS OPERATED INDEPENDENTLY AND IS NOT REVIEWED OR ENDORSED BY SOLIX TECHNOLOGIES, INC. IN AN OFFICIAL CAPACITY. ALL THIRD-PARTY TRADEMARKS, LOGOS, AND COPYRIGHTED MATERIALS REFERENCED HEREIN ARE THE PROPERTY OF THEIR RESPECTIVE OWNERS. ANY USE IS STRICTLY FOR IDENTIFICATION, COMMENTARY, OR EDUCATIONAL PURPOSES UNDER THE DOCTRINE OF FAIR USE (U.S. COPYRIGHT ACT § 107 AND INTERNATIONAL EQUIVALENTS). NO SPONSORSHIP, ENDORSEMENT, OR AFFILIATION WITH SOLIX TECHNOLOGIES, INC. IS IMPLIED. CONTENT IS PROVIDED "AS-IS" WITHOUT WARRANTIES OF ACCURACY, COMPLETENESS, OR FITNESS FOR ANY PURPOSE. SOLIX TECHNOLOGIES, INC. DISCLAIMS ALL LIABILITY FOR ACTIONS TAKEN BASED ON THIS MATERIAL. READERS ASSUME FULL RESPONSIBILITY FOR THEIR USE OF THIS INFORMATION. SOLIX RESPECTS INTELLECTUAL PROPERTY RIGHTS. TO SUBMIT A DMCA TAKEDOWN REQUEST, EMAIL INFO@SOLIX.COM WITH: (1) IDENTIFICATION OF THE WORK, (2) THE INFRINGING MATERIAL’S URL, (3) YOUR CONTACT DETAILS, AND (4) A STATEMENT OF GOOD FAITH. VALID CLAIMS WILL RECEIVE PROMPT ATTENTION. BY ACCESSING THIS BLOG, YOU AGREE TO THIS DISCLAIMER AND OUR TERMS OF USE. THIS AGREEMENT IS GOVERNED BY THE LAWS OF CALIFORNIA.
-
White Paper
Enterprise Information Architecture for Gen AI and Machine Learning
Download White Paper -
-
-
